Goggle Product Care

Your I/S Eyewear goggles are a technical piece of equipment that require special care.
These instructions may be difficult to follow initially, but they will help to keep your goggles’ lasting for years.

Lens Maintenance

  1. Always store your goggles inside the I/S Eyewear goggle bag
  2. Only use the micro-fiber goggle bag included with your purchase or another micro-fiber cloth to clean your lens. Wash your goggle bag as much as you need.
  3. DO NOT USE YOUR GLOVES TO DIG OUT SNOW/ICE. RUBBING WITH GLOVES CAN SCRATCH THE INSIDE OF YOUR LENS OR WEAR AWAY THE ANTI-FOG COATING.
  4. Clean your lens using only warm water and your goggle bag. Do not use any solvents or cleaning products, as they may damage the lens or mirror coatings.
  5. Allow your lens to dry fully before storing it in a well ventilated area. Do not expose the lens to extreme heat.
  6. Always stack multiple lenses with a soft cloth between them.

 
Getting the most out of your Goggles
While I/S eyewear has a reputation for the best anti-fog in the business, there’s some things you can do to minimize the occurrence.

  1. The top of your head has lots of moisture (snow, perspiration, etc.), which can condense on the inside of your lens.
  2. After a hot, sweaty run, avoid taking your goggles off and putting them on your forehead or helmet. Its better to just keep them on.
  3. If you should crash and get snow inside your goggle, carefully tap out as much as possible, then use your goggle bag to dry the inside of the lens as much as possible. DO NOT USE YOUR GLOVES TO DIG OUT SNOW/ICE, YOU CAN SCRATCH THE INSIDE OF YOUR LENS. Ventilation will help dry your goggle, so get moving!
  4. Air dry your goggles before you store them.

Replacing your T-tab in the Forma Frame

Under extreme conditions, the T-tab in Forma frames can break, but we’ve got a fix. Watch the video below for instructions. If you don’t have a replacement T-tab, email us at info@iseyewear.com and we’ll mail one to you right away.

Lens Maintenance
Follow these steps to ensure that your sunglass lenses last a long, scratch-free existence:

  1. Store your glasses inside the protective pouch that they came with
  2. Only use the micro-fiber, lint-free lens cleaner. Do not use any solvents or cleaning products, as they may damage the lens or mirror coatings.
  3. Don’t sit on them. Our warranty doesn’t cover sitting on your shades.

 
Hinge Adjustment
Over time, hinges can loosen causing the temple arms to swing into the lens or wiggle slightly. If you have a loose hinge, tighten the screw at the top of the hinge with a precision flathead screwdriver. Do not over-tighten the hinge, often an 1/8 of a turn is enough.
